Oborevwori unstoppable in 2027 – Oghenesivbe

By Our Reporter Jul 20, 2025 1 min read
Share:

…Says Deltans are solidly behind their performing governor

Director General, Delta State Orientation and Communications Bureau, Dr Fred Latimore Oghenesivbe, has again expressed optimism that governor Sheriff Oborevwori, will be reelected in 2027, no matter the political thunderstorms.

He gave the assurance during a radio political program monitored in Asaba on Saturday, saying that the governor remains the most trusted politician and selfless leader judging from his unmatched popularity, public acceptance, positive aura and magnetic charisma.

He noted that Oborevwori’s genuine commitment towards advancing Delta had consistently earned him accolades and national Awards, pointing out that as the political atmosphere gathers momentum, the governor’s team, loyalists and statewide political structures would once again rise to the occasion and paint Delta yellow.

The Bureau Chief assured that by the special grace of God, governor Oborevwori would complete his eight years tenure on May 29, 2031, and that no mortal or political scheming can stop him from winning the governorship election overwhelming in 2027.

“I can tell you for free that governor Oborevwori shall be unstoppable in 2027. In fact, it’s already foreseeable that he would shock his political detractors.

“All kinds of talks and permutations are making the rounds on social media platforms, but all that will soon give way for political reality and mass mobilization.

“Deltans are solidly behind their governor, and in the near future we shall all be faced with reality, and that is to say governor Oborevwori would expand his political tentacles, and sustain his lead as the biggest political masquerade of our time,” Oghenesivbe said.
